Purpose Of The Role

  • The Lead Structural Designer is responsible for leading the offshore drafting team in the development, and delivery of detailing solutions that meet project, client, and regulatory requirements. The role provides technical leadership, supervision, and mentoring to draftin team Lead/Sr. Designer and drafts man ensuring that designs are safe, efficient, and compliant with industry codes and company standards. In addition to preparing and reviewing Principal Structural Designer coordinates with multidisciplinary teams, manages technical interfaces, and supports Lead Engineers in achieving successful outcomes. The position plays a key role in resource planning, resolving technical challenges, and driving continuous improvement in engineering practices, contributing to Worley's commitment to excellence and innovation.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ead the structural design team in delivering high-quality, code-compliant solutions.
  • Oversee the development of detailed drawings, 3D models, and design deliverables and ensuring alignment with project schedules, budget and technical requirements to completion.
  • Ensure compliance with project specifications and international standards and regulations.
  • Collaborate with engineers, project managers, and clients to meet project goals.
  • Provide technical guidance and promote best practices in design execution.
  • Able to assist and troubleshoot issues with systems, processes and tools, and its possible enhancements.
  • Provide leadership, guidance, and mentorship to engineers and designers.
  • Conduct site investigations, prepare reports
  • Ensure that work is checked effectively before issue.
  • Assist Lead in conducting regular quality audits.
  • Ensure that costs are effectively controlled on work assigned to design / drafting personnel within assigned team
  • Estimate cost, time and resource requirements for design / drafting work in cooperation with project engineers and Lead Discipline Engineer within asset.
  • Manage design documentation and drawings.
  • Evidence that documents are registered, controlled, tracked and filed effectively – in accordance with procedures, using standard systems.
  • Preparation of detail designs in conjunction with engineers
  • Work is carried out competently and effectively within time and budget constraints and project objectives are satisfied.
  • Liaison with other disciplines on technical issues.

Qualifications

  • Certificate, Diploma or Degree in Civil/Structural Engineering or Drafting
  • Relevant years of experience in structural design, with experience in a lead role
  • Experience in Fixed/Floating Offshore structures design in greenfield and brownfield projects
  • Advanced proficiency in E3D, SP3D, BOCAD or TEKLA
  • Knowledge in driving 3D modelling review, tagging and closing out all tags
  • Knowledge in resolving all the clashes in 3D modelling, extraction drawings
  • Strong understanding of offshore structures, steel detailing, and fabrication methods.
  • Must have strong fabrication drawings preparations
  • Strong knowledge of structural codes and standards for effective detailing
  • Excellent communication and leadership skills.
